An important step into the future for the company is the Scalability+ concept, advanced technology that maximizes the overall modularity and flexibility of machines and systems and allows machine manufacturers to select a hardware and software solution that best fits their automation needs - all without having to enter into any kind of commitment. The modular Panel PC platform is an important component of Scalability+. The newest system in this platform, the Panel PC 2100, will be presented to the public for the first time. All 2nd generation Automation Panels - both the rack-mounted and support arm variants - can be upgraded to a powerful Panel PC system simply by installing the PC module. Taking advantage of innovative Bay Trail architecture from Intel, the PC module is as compact as a DVI/SDL receiver. At the same time, the computing power is fully scalable, with single-core, dual-core or quad-core processors available depending on the actual requirements of the user.
